QM Superposition Package
written by Mario Belloni and Wolfgang Christian
The QM Superposition Launcher package is a self-contained file for the teaching of the time evolution and visualization of energy eigenstates and their superpositions in quantum mechanics.  The file contains ready-to-run OSP programs and a curricular materials.  One can choose from several real-time visualizations, such as the position and momentum expectation values and the Wigner quasi-probability distribution for position and momentum.

The QM Superposition package is an Open Source Physics curricular package written for the teaching of quantum mechanics.  It is distributed as a ready-to-run (compiled) Java archive.  Double clicking the osp_superposition.jar file will run the package if Java is installed.  Other quantum mechanics packages are also available.  They can be found by searching ComPADRE for Open Source Physics, OSP, or Quantum Mechanics.

Please note that this resource requires at least version 1.5 of Java.
